Coca-Cola and Mercedes-Benz are Driving the Future of Sustainable Transport

Mercedes-Benz eActros

Coca-Cola is a global brand synonymous with happiness, celebration, and joy. But did you know that Coca-Cola is also committed to reducing its environmental impact and promoting sustainable transport? Now, you’ll discover how Coca-Cola partnered with Mercedes-Benz to use the eActros, an innovative electric truck, to deliver its products across Austria during the festive season.

What is the eActros?

The Mercedes-Benz eActros is a heavy-duty truck that runs on electricity instead of diesel. It was developed by Mercedes-Benz, a leading manufacturer of commercial vehicles, as part of its vision to achieve carbon-neutral transport by 2039.

The eActros has a range of up to 200 kilometers (124 miles) on a single charge, depending on the load and the route. It can carry up to 18 tons of cargo and has a maximum speed of 85 kilometers per hour (53 miles per hour).

The Mercedes-Benz eActros is powered by two electric motors that are located close to the rear axle. The motors are connected to the wheels by a single-speed transmission. The electric power comes from lithium-ion batteries that are mounted on the frame of the vehicle. The batteries have a capacity of 240 kilowatt-hours and can be fully charged in about two hours.

The eActros also features many advanced technologies that enhance its performance, safety, and comfort. For example, it has a MirrorCam system that replaces the conventional rear-view mirrors with cameras and displays. It also has a Sideguard Assist system that warns the driver of moving objects in the blind spot. It has a Multimedia Cockpit that provides the driver with all the relevant information and controls on a digital dashboard.

Why did Coca-Cola choose the eActros?

Coca-Cola is one of the world’s largest beverage companies, with more than 500 brands and 1.9 billion servings per day. Coca-Cola is also one of the world’s largest consumers of road transport, with more than 100,000 trucks and vans in its fleet.

Coca-Cola has a long history of supporting environmental and social causes, such as water conservation, recycling, and community development. Coca-Cola also has a sustainability strategy that aims to reduce its greenhouse gas emissions by 25% by 2030, compared to 2015 levels.

One of the ways that Coca-Cola is pursuing its sustainability goals is by investing in alternative fuels and low-emission vehicles. Coca-Cola has been using natural gas, biodiesel, ethanol, and hybrid vehicles in some of its markets for years. Coca-Cola has also been testing electric vehicles, such as the eActros, in various countries, such as Germany, Switzerland, Belgium, and the Netherlands.

Coca-Cola decided to use the eActros in Austria for several reasons. First, Austria is a country that has a high share of renewable energy in its electricity mix, which makes electric vehicles more environmentally friendly. Second, Austria is a country that has a lot of mountainous terrain, which poses a challenge for electric vehicles. Third, Austria is a country that has a strong tradition of celebrating Christmas, which creates a high demand for Coca-Cola products.

How did Coca-Cola use the eActros?

During the Christmas truck tour, Coca-Cola used the eActros electric truck to deliver its products to various locations in Austria. The Christmas truck tour is a popular event that has been organized by Coca-Cola since 1997. The tour involves a convoy of brightly decorated trucks that travel across different cities and towns, spreading festive cheer and giving out free drinks and gifts.

The eActros was part of the Christmas truck tour from November 15 to December 24, 2023. The eActros covered a total distance of about 2,800 kilometers (1,740 miles) and delivered about 36,000 crates of Coca-Cola products. The eActros was driven by two drivers who alternated every four hours. The eActros was charged at night at the Coca-Cola warehouse in Vienna, which was also loaded with the products.

The Mercedes-Benz eActros performed well during the Christmas truck tour despite the challenging weather and road conditions. The eActros did not encounter any technical issues or breakdowns. The eActros also received positive feedback from the drivers, who praised its smooth and quiet operation, spacious and comfortable cabin, and easy and intuitive handling.

The eActros also attracted a lot of attention and curiosity from the public, who were impressed by its futuristic design, zero-emission operation, and association with Coca-Cola. The eActros was featured in several media outlets, such as newspapers, TV channels, and social media platforms. The eActros also generated a lot of interest and inquiries from other potential customers, such as logistics companies, retailers, and municipalities.

What are the benefits of the eActros?

The eActros offers a number of benefits for both Coca-Cola and the environment. Some of the benefits are:

  • Reduced emissions: The eActros does not emit any carbon dioxide, nitrogen oxides, or particulate matter, which are harmful to the climate and human health. The eActros also reduces noise pollution, improving the residents' and drivers' quality of life. According to Mercedes-Benz, the eActros can save up to 60 tons of carbon dioxide per year compared to a conventional diesel truck.
  • Lower costs: The eActros has lower operating costs than a diesel truck due to its higher energy efficiency, lower maintenance needs, and cheaper electricity prices. The eActros also benefits from tax incentives and subsidies for electric vehicles in some countries. According to Mercedes-Benz, the eActros can save up to 20% of the total cost of ownership compared to a diesel truck.
  • Improved image: The eActros enhances the image and reputation of Coca-Cola as a responsible and innovative company that cares about the environment and society. The eActros also helps Coca-Cola differentiate itself from its competitors and attract and retain customers who value sustainability and quality.

What are the challenges of the eActros?

The eActros also faces some challenges that must be overcome before it can become widely adopted. Some of the challenges are:

  • Limited range: The eActros has a limited range of up to 200 kilometers (124 miles) on a single charge, which limits its suitability for long-distance transport. The range of the eActros also depends on the load, the route, the weather, and the driving style. The eActros needs to be recharged frequently, which requires access to charging stations and sufficient time.
  • High price: The eActros has a high purchase price due to the high cost of the batteries and the electric motors. The eActros is currently about three times more expensive than a diesel truck, according to Mercedes-Benz. The eActros also has a high depreciation rate due to the rapid development and innovation of electric vehicle technology. The eActros needs to achieve economies of scale and technological breakthroughs to become more affordable and competitive.
  • Lack of infrastructure: The eActros requires a reliable and adequate infrastructure to support its operation and maintenance. The eActros needs access to charging stations that can provide enough power and speed to recharge the batteries. The eActros also needs access to service centers that can provide specialized and qualified technicians and spare parts. The Mercedes-Benz eActros needs to have a coordinated and standardized infrastructure across different regions and countries to enable seamless and efficient transport.
